Training and Socialization

German Shepherd puppies are highly intelligent and eager to please, making them relatively easy to train. Early socialization is crucial to ensure they grow into well-adjusted adults. Exposing them to various environments, people, and animals will help prevent any potential behavioral issues. Consistent training and positive reinforcement methods are essential for shaping their behavior. If you’re considering adding a German Shepherd puppy to your family, be sure to invest the time and effort into their training and socialization to help them reach their full potential.

From their first few weeks of life, German Shepherd Puppies display their intelligence and eagerness to learn. Their intelligent nature makes them quick learners, whether it’s basic obedience commands or more advanced tasks. Training should be consistent, firm, and fair, utilizing positive reinforcement techniques such as treats, praise, and play. With proper training and socialization, German Shepherd puppies can grow into well-behaved, loyal companions for life.
